Mali is among the ten poorest nations of the world, is one of the 37 Heavily Indebted … olde english chippy kimberleyNettet20. mai 2024 · During his reign, Mali was one of the richest kingdoms of Africa, and Mansa Musa was among the richest individuals in the … olde english bulldogge weightNettetMali and its king were elevated to near legendary status, cemented by their inclusion on the 1375 Catalan Atlas. One of the most important world maps of Medieval Europe, it depicted the King holding a scepter and a gleaming gold nugget. Mansa Musa had literally put his empire and himself on the map.
